Hmm, of those you listed, I would recommend: Vi - Pretty versatile jungler with good ganks, dueling and objective control. She can be build with damage when snowballing, or tanky when even or behind. She is great for dive compositions.

Zed Good AD assassin assuming you know how to play him. Very strong as a duelist and splitpusher in the late game and has a pretty safe laning phase.

RekSai Seems to be a very mobile jungler with strong ganks and burst damage. If you want to get her, I'd recommend waiting until the next patch to see how Riot changes her.

Azir Strong champion with good zoning, battlefield control and DPS. He's weak against mobility and burst damage though, so you have to be careful with his positioning. Also, he's been pretty notorious for bugs recently, so I'm not sure what his current state is.

Velkoz Very high base damages, high burst, high AoE damage, good CC. His main weakness is that he is immobile, squishy, and relies entirely on hitting skillshots. Good champion, but vulnerable to ganks and gapclosers.

Champions I might suggest avoiding at the moment: Khazix Can have a tough time in the new jungle if he doesn't snowball due to the monster camps getting stronger. Also, Riot seems to have changed his abilities (which changes his build and playstyle) several time recently, so he may be subject to more changes in the future if he becomes strong again.

Quinn Can be a good bully, but is generally outperformed by most other AD carries. Can also be used top lane, but I think Vayne and Gnar are probably better picks top at the moment.

Yasuo He pretty good when other champions on your team have knock-ups or knock-backs, but the changes to his shield have made him more vulnerable than before. You can try him if you want, but I would recommend waiting for a free week first to see if you like him.
